linux 9 檔案系統的壓縮與打包 dump

2021-06-20 07:31:00 字數 463 閱讀 1540

9.檔案系統的壓縮與打包

常見的壓縮命令: .tar,.tar.gz,tgz,.gz,.z,.bz2

完整備份工具:dump

用dump備份完成的檔案系統

帶備份的資料為單一檔案系統,帶備份的資料只能是目錄,不能是單一檔案

df -h  找出檔案系統

dump -s /dev/hdc1 測試備份這個資料需要多大的容量

dump -0u -f /root/boot.dump  /boot 將boot這個檔案系統備份為/root/boot.dump   

用dump備份目錄而非單一檔案系統

用dump備份/etc檔案系統

dump -0j -f /root/etc.dump.bz2 /etc

restore 恢復資料

用restore檢視dump後的備份資料內容:

restore -t -f /root/boot.dump

9 檔案與檔案系統

1.讀寫檔案 open 方法用於開啟乙個檔案,並返回檔案物件 注意 1 使用 open 方法一定要保證關閉檔案物件,即呼叫 close 方法。2 open 函式常用形式是接收兩個引數 檔名 file 和模式 mode open file mode r fo open r.txt wb print 檔...

U9檔案與檔案系統的壓縮和打包

1.在linux的環境中,壓縮檔案的副檔名大多為 tar,tar.gz,tgz,bz2.2.gzip可以說是應用最廣的壓縮命令了 目前gzip可以揭開compress,zip和gzip等軟體壓縮的檔案 gzip所建立的壓縮檔案的檔名為 gz 使用gzip壓縮的檔案在windows系統中,竟然可以被w...

Day 9 檔案與檔案系統

在寫入其他型別的物件之前,需要先把它們轉化為字串 在文字模式下 或者位元組物件 在二進位制模式下 f.read size 檔案末尾 f.read 將返回乙個空字串 f.readline 從文中讀取 for line in f print line,end this is the first line...